Sec. 39.53  Energy compensation source.

    The licensee may use an energy compensation source (ECS) which is 
contained within a logging tool, or other tool components, only if the 
ECS contains quantities of licensed material not exceeding 3.7 MBq [100 
microcuries].
    (a) For well logging applications with a surface casing for 
protecting fresh water aquifers, use of the ECS is only subject to the 
requirements of Secs. 39.35, 39.37 and 39.39.
    (b) For well logging applications without a surface casing for 
protecting fresh water aquifers, use of the ECS is only subject to the 
requirements of Secs. 39.15, 39.35, 39.37, 39.39, 39.51, and 39.77.
